Quick answer
When an AC will not turn on, the cause is usually electrical and usually cheap: a thermostat not calling for cooling, a tripped breaker or blown fuse in the outdoor disconnect, a failed capacitor or contactor, or a safety switch on the condensate drain. Check the thermostat and breakers first. If the outdoor unit hums but never starts, stop and call a technician.
If you're asking why your AC is not turning on, start by noticing exactly what is and isn't happening. There are three different problems hiding behind that one complaint: nothing runs at all, the indoor fan runs but the outdoor unit is silent, or the outdoor unit hums or clicks but the fan never spins. Each points at a different part, and the first two are often something you can sort out yourself in 10 minutes.
Nothing runs at all: check the thermostat and the furnace power
If the indoor blower is silent and the outdoor unit is dead, the cooling call is not reaching the equipment. Confirm the thermostat is set to Cool with the setpoint at least 2°C below room temperature, and swap the batteries if it is a battery model; a dim or blank screen is the giveaway. Many thermostats also hold a five-minute compressor delay after a power blip, so wait it out before deciding anything is broken.
- The furnace power switch: the indoor half of your AC is the furnace blower. That light-switch beside the furnace gets knocked off by a laundry basket more often than you would think.
- The furnace breaker: usually a 15-amp single breaker in the panel, separate from the AC's own breaker.
- The 3-amp blade fuse on the furnace control board: it protects the 24-volt circuit and blows when a thermostat wire shorts. If a new fuse blows immediately, a low-voltage wire is shorted somewhere and needs tracing.
- The condensate float switch: on newer installs a small switch in the drain pan or line cuts the cooling call when water backs up. It should never be bypassed; find out why an AC leaks water inside and clear the drain instead.
Indoor fan runs, outdoor unit silent: look at the disconnect and breaker
When the blower runs but the condenser outside does nothing, the problem is between the panel and the outdoor unit. The condenser has its own two-pole breaker, typically 20 to 40 amps, and a weatherproof disconnect box on the wall beside it. Older disconnects in 1970s–90s subdivisions like Tyandaga and Millcroft often use pull-out cartridge fuses, and a blown cartridge looks normal from the outside; it takes a meter to tell.
A breaker that trips again within minutes is a different conversation; see why an AC trips the breaker. Also check the thin low-voltage wire that runs from the furnace to the condenser. String trimmers cut it in June, and mice chew it over winter when they nest in the base of the unit. A severed 24-volt wire means the contactor never gets the signal to pull in.
The contactor itself is a relay whose two contacts pit and burn over years of cycling. Ants are drawn into the enclosure and get crushed between the contacts, which sounds like a tall tale and is a genuine cause of a dead condenser. A worn contactor is a small part and one of the fixes in the $150–$350 band.
Outdoor unit hums or clicks but won't start: stop and call
A hum with no fan movement almost always means a failed run capacitor. The compressor and fan motor both need it to start, and when it weakens the motors just sit there drawing current and getting hot. Do not push the fan blade with a stick to get it going; your hand is beside a live fan, and running the unit on a dead capacitor leaves the compressor straining on locked-rotor current. Switch it off at the thermostat and call; the part and the price are covered in how much an AC capacitor costs.
Rapid clicking is usually the contactor chattering because the control voltage is low or its coil is failing. A loud buzz followed by silence, repeating every few minutes, can be the compressor going out on its internal overload. Cut the power at the breaker if it keeps trying; repeated locked-rotor starts do real damage.
What it costs to get an AC running again
- Diagnostic visit: $90–$150 and folded into the repair if you go ahead with it.
- Capacitor or contactor: $150–$350 including the part and the labour.
- Clogged condensate drain that tripped the float switch: cleared for $150–$350.
- Blown fuse or tripped breaker with no underlying fault: often just the diagnostic charge, plus an explanation of why it happened.
Most no-start calls are resolved in a single visit for $150–$450. The exception is a compressor that has failed electrically on an older unit; that is the moment to weigh repairing a 10-year-old AC against replacing it.
Why the first hot week is when this happens
A unit that has sat since September is being asked to start cold on the first 30°C afternoon, usually the same afternoon everyone else's is. Capacitors that lost capacity over the winter fail on that first hard start. Rodent damage, a cover left on, and a breaker someone switched off in the fall all surface at once. Running the AC for 10 minutes on a May day above 15°C, before you need it, catches most of this while a service slot is easy to get.
